Someday after José Andrés’ World Central Kitchen confirmed that seven of its workforce offering meals in Gaza had been killed in an Israel Protection Forces strike, President Biden referred to as Andrés personally to inform the celeb chef he was “heartbroken” by the information.
“The president conveyed he’s grieving with all the World Central Kitchen household,” White Home press secretary Karine Jean-Pierre mentioned in a media briefing at the moment. “The president felt it was necessary to acknowledge the great contribution World Central Kitchen has made to the folks in Gaza and folks all over the world.”
Jean-Pierre added that Biden “additionally conveyed to Andrés that he’ll clarify to Israel that humanitarian help employees have to be protected.”
Andrés first rose to fame along with his Spanish cooking present Vamos a Cocinar, and later based World Central Kitchen. The non-profit, non-governmental group dedicated to offering meals in catastrophe zones equivalent to Haiti after the earthquake, within the U.S. after Hurricane Harvey and in Ukraine after the Russian invasion.
In accordance with World Central Kitchen, its workforce “was touring in a deconflicted zone in two armored automobiles branded with the WCK emblem and a gentle pores and skin car.
“Regardless of coordinating actions with the IDF, the convoy was hit because it was leaving the Deir al-Balah warehouse, the place the workforce had unloaded greater than 100 tons of humanitarian meals help delivered to Gaza on the maritime route.”
Israel launched a army investigation into the strike and, based on native media, discovered that the military recognized the automobiles carrying World Central Kitchen’s employees arriving on the warehouse in Deir al-Balah and likewise noticed suspected militants close by. A short while later, the automobiles had been struck by the Israel Air Drive as they headed away.
“This isn’t solely an assault in opposition to WCK, that is an assault on humanitarian organizations exhibiting up in essentially the most dire of conditions the place meals is getting used as a weapon of conflict. That is unforgivable,” mentioned World Central Kitchen CEO Erin Gore in an announcement.
On account of the deaths, World Central Kitchen has paused meals deliveries in Gaza, the place consultants say famine is imminent.
